Lang Son launches digital border gate platform at Huu Nghi border gate
A representative of the People's Committee of Lang Son province said that after issuing a document on the official pilot of the Digital Border Gate Platform, Lang Son Province conducted training, supported and guided the pilot implementation at Huu Nghi international border gate.
Accordingly, from 8am to 10am every day from January 20 to February 20, the People's Committee of Lang Son province requested businesses involved in import and export activities, transportation, and drivers through Huu Nghi international border gate to proactively arrange a time to attend the training course on the implementation the Digital Border Gate Platform at the Meeting Room on the 5th floor, Huu Nghi border gate building.

From February 21, the People's Committee of Lang Son province required businesses involved in import and export activities, transportation, and drivers through Huu Nghi international border gate to declare on the platform. Those who do not declare on the platform will be forced to suspend their imports, exports and transportation until they make a declaration on this digital platform.
The process of using the digital border gate platform includes eight steps: Declaring information; transporting import and export goods; controlling the flow of means of transport of import and export goods; medical examination; inspecting means of transport of imported and exported goods in and out of the border gate area; quarantine of animals and plants; transhipment of goods and goods inspection; collecting fees for the use of infrastructure works, service works and public utilities in the border gate area.
When applying the digital border gate, the imports and exports will be automated, helping reduce the time for businesses and improve openness and transparency in management activities at the border gate.
The contents and processes related to Customs duties on the Digital Border Gate Platform will comply with Notice 111 dated January 17, 2022 of Huu Nghi Border Gate Customs Branch.

Nguyen Khac Lich, Director of Lang Son Department of Information and Communications, said that the digital border gate platform applies many modern technologies such as AI, big data, and cloud computing. The database is centralized and able to connect and share via the Provincial Data Sharing, Integration and Connection Axis.
On January 13, Lang Son Provincial People's Committee issued Official Letter 57 on officially piloting the digital border gate platform.
Businesses and relevant authorities officially piloted the digital border gate platform from January 14, 2022 at Huu Nghi international border gate on the principle of meeting the professional regulations of the relevant sectors and maximizing processes and procedures of import-export enterprises who make online declarations of goods, input means of transport and changing from manual data importation into online inspection, supervision and confirmation on the digital border gate platform.
